Description
The MPS on behalf of the Contracting Authority (MOPAC) has awarded a contract for a small number of evidential screening devices(ESD's) for the Christmas Drink Drive campaign. Without service continuation the Authority would experience and be exposed to operational risk due the nature of the environment these products are required for. This contract was awarded for a year to allow time to publish an ITT for a tender and therefore are enacting a negotiated procedure without publication with the current supplier. The MPS shall be relying on PCR Regulation 32(2)(c) whereby insofar as is strictly necessary where, for reasons of extreme urgency brought about by events unforeseeable by the contracting authority, the time limits for the open or restricted procedures or competitive procedures with negotiation cannot be complied with. The award of contract via the negotiated procedure shall provide adequate time to the Authority to run a competition whilst safeguarding service delivery of ESD's for the foreseeable future. The negotiated award of contract shall commence 3rd November. The Authority expects a replacement contract to be awarded 2024.
